  13. I own 2 Pulses and several others from different manufactures. I've been jumping since 1976 so I have a little more experience and yes, older! I love the Pulse, it's a great all around canopy. Handling is great and landings are pretty much a no-brainer. Disclaimer: I've never jumped a Shiloutte (sp) so I can't compare the two. Whichever you decide buy new if you can afford it. BTW there's a reason why you don't see Used Pulse canopies or sale, they get snapped up!
